Crime Advisory: Robertson County
Safety Verdict
Robertson County has a safety score of 33/100, indicating a higher crime area with moderate overall crime (1556.7 incidents per 100,000 residents, 2022 data).
Violent vs. Property Crime
Violent crime stands at 368.4 per 100K and property crime at 1188.3 per 100K (2022 data). In this county, property crime is notably higher.
Data Coverage
This data reflects partial coverage from 8 law enforcement agencies in Robertson County for 2022. Figures may underrepresent actual crime levels due to incomplete reporting.
State Comparison
Compared to the rest of Tennessee, total crime is 13% below the Tennessee average and its safety score is 3 points below the state mean.
